As the summer is approaching, many different vending opportunities are arriving and with that, new fragrances as well! Ladies and Gents: Behold Paige’s Perfections’ 3 New Fragrances:

Love Spell. “I Put a Spell on You, and Now You’re Mine” A sultry combination of Cherry Blossoms and Citrus, infused with Orange and Grapefruit Essential Oils. Perfect to attract your Perfect match ;)

Sweet Earl Grey. This is my favorite new scent so far! This lovely blend of Black Tea leaves, Bergamot Orange rinds, Currants and Raspberry leaves create a sweeter version of the Classic Earl Grey tea we all know and love. Perfect for a lovely summer day.

Tropical Breeze. Enjoy the Summer sun with the exotic flavors of Pineapple, Banana, and Coconut combining to transport you to a tropical island to enjoy a calm, clear ocean breeze. Fruity but not overpowering, this wonderful scent is a must have for warm weather!

I have to admit, I am in love with The Point; a nonprofit Community Development Corporation dedicated to youth development and the cultural and economic revitalization of the Hunts Point section of the South Bronx [Edited Excerpt].
